Use of Oracle Database Express Edition (XE) Test
The Oracle Database Express Edition (XE) test is a crucial test tool designed for evaluating the technical competencies required to manage and operate Oracle's lightweight, yet powerful database solution. As businesses increasingly rely on data-driven insights, the ability to effectively handle database systems becomes indispensable. This test plays a vital role in recruitment processes across various industries, ensuring that candidates possess the necessary skills to maintain and optimize Oracle Database XE environments.
Database Installation and Setup is the foundational skill assessed in this test. It evaluates a candidate's ability to install and configure Oracle Database XE, covering important aspects such as system prerequisites, user account creation, and database initialization. Understanding listener configurations and troubleshooting installation issues are critical components of this skill. In real-world scenarios, candidates are expected to deploy Oracle XE in both local and cloud environments, ensuring compatibility with operating systems and securing the initial setup.
SQL Query Design and Execution is another essential skill. This aspect of the test assesses proficiency in writing optimized SQL queries, including SELECT statements, joins, and subqueries. The ability to tune query performance, apply indexing strategies, and interpret execution plans is crucial. These skills enable candidates to extract actionable insights from datasets, manage large volumes of data efficiently, and design reusable query templates for various operational and analytical purposes.
Data Backup and Recovery is a vital skill for protecting data integrity and ensuring business continuity. The test evaluates candidates' ability to manage Oracle XE backups and recovery processes, including configuring automatic backups and executing point-in-time recovery techniques. Practical scenarios involve protecting databases from corruption or loss and ensuring minimal downtime through tested disaster recovery workflows.
Schema Design and Management measures expertise in creating and modifying database schemas, including table creation, constraints, and normalization. Candidates must demonstrate knowledge of primary and foreign keys, indexing, and implementing schema changes without affecting database performance. This skill supports evolving business requirements while maintaining data integrity.
PL/SQL Development is crucial for automation and efficiency in database operations. The test assesses the ability to develop efficient PL/SQL scripts for triggers, functions, and stored procedures. Candidates must understand error handling, debugging, and performance optimization to create reusable database logic, automate repetitive tasks, and integrate complex business rules into workflows.
Performance Monitoring and Optimization evaluates the ability to monitor and optimize Oracle XE database performance using tools like AWR reports and execution plans. This skill involves tuning queries, managing system resources, and addressing bottlenecks. It is essential for improving database responsiveness under high transaction loads and ensuring consistent performance for critical applications.
Overall, the Oracle Database Express Edition (XE) test is indispensable for selecting candidates who can effectively manage and optimize database systems. It is relevant across industries such as IT, finance, healthcare, and any sector reliant on robust data management solutions.
